문제 6209
화씨(℉)를 섭씨(℃)로 변환하는 프로그램을 작성하십시오.
이 때 물의 빙점은 화씨 32도이고 비등점은 화씨 212도(표준 기압에서)입니다.
물의 비등점과 빙점 사이에 정확하게 180도 차이가 납니다.
그러므로 화씨 눈금에서의 간격은 물의 빙점과 비등점 사이의 간격의 1/180입니다.
[입력]
82
[출력]
82.00 ℉ => 27.78 ℃
푼 줄 알았는데....?... 흠
무튼 화씨랑 섭씨 변환식을 까먹어서 VSCode를 계산기처럼 활용해서 ㅋㅋ 차이를 찾고 계산했다.
F = int(input())
C = (F - 32) / 1.8
print(f'{F:.2f} ℉ => {C:.2f} ℃')
수업시간에 f-string을 자주 봐서 f-string을 활용해서 써봤다
(사실 .format 쓰는 건 그새 까먹었다 ㅎ)
아, 소수점 자리수 표현하는 건 몰라서 검색해봤다.
f-string 에서는 위의 코드 블록에 있는 것처럼 하면 된다.
소수점 2자리까지 표시할 거라면 .2f! f는 실수를 의미하는 float에서 따온 것.
문제 6216
20% 농도의 소금물 100g과 물 200g을 혼합한 소금물의 농도(%)를 소수점 두 번째 자리까지 구하는 프로그램을 작성하십시오.
[출력]
혼합된 소금물의 농도: 6.67%
입력 값도 없고 그냥 프린트 하면 되는 문제... 맞나?
GSAT 준비할 때 자주 풀었던 문제라 식 세우는 건 어렵지 않았다
소금물의 농도 = (소금/물) * 100 만 기억하면 된다
result = (100 * 0.2) / (100 + 200) * 100
print(f'혼합된 소금물의 농도: {result:.2f}%')
'Algorithm > SW Expert Amademy' 카테고리의 다른 글
| SWEA 1208. Flatten (파이썬) (0) | 2022.02.27 |
|---|---|
| 4835. 파이썬 S/W 문제해결(알고리즘) | 구간합 (0) | 2022.02.14 |
| 6206. 파이썬 연산자 연습 문제 (0) | 2022.01.25 |
| 6314. 파이썬 내장함수 연습문제 2 (0) | 2022.01.16 |
| 6313. 파이썬 내장함수 연습문제 1 (0) | 2022.01.16 |